** INDIA [and non]. 13710, AIR GOS for SE Asia, Dec 10 at 1456 with final news
summary by YL, not hard to understand; with some flutter, better than // 9690
and inaudible 11620; axually atop the Cuban leapfrog producing a SAH, from RHC
Spanish 13770 over CRI English 13740. Mentioned that today is Human Rights Day;
sign off gave frequencies for next broadcast to SE Asia from 2045. Off at 1500
clearing frequency for Cuba, as I could hear both RHC IS and CRI English mixing
(Glenn Hauser, OK, DX LISTENING DIGEST)
** ITALY [non]. 15410-15460, noise blob centered around 15435, Dec 10 at 1416,
half a sesquihour before the BSKSA 15435 blob comes on, different sound, and
gradually tapering off to spikes at edges, such as 15410 against R. Farda.
Suspected of local origin, especially after I find similar slightly weaker blob
15145-15190 and traces of a third at 15680, roughly equal intervals. What
appliances are running now? Oil heater, halfway on. Turn it off, noise goes
away! Turn it fully on, noise much reduced. Kinda need it with temps in the lo
F teens. It`s a DeLonghi, made in Italy, Type 2507, which has two 750 watt
units. I hereby absolve all editors of any expectation of publishing this as a
genuine log, altho I was capturing it some 10 meters away, and would be
justified in issuing myself a proxy QSL (Glenn Hauser, Enid OK, DX LISTENING
DIGEST)

** RUSSIA. 6075 via Petropavlovsk/Kamchatskiy, Dec 10 at 1359 with music and
final announcement this time, IDing as R. Rossii, before 4-second late
timesignal at 1400*. No 8GAL audible then on 6074, nor anything from Taiwan or
China on 6075. RR transmitter slightly unstable, but the rumble much reduced
(Glenn Hauser, OK, DX LISTENING DIGEST)
** U S A [and non]. 9955, WRMI relaying R. Prague, good signal vs DentroCuban
jamming pulses at 0710 Dec 10. Per Jeff White, WRMI will only be using the SSE
antenna a while longer until the NW antenna can be repaired by mid-December.
Unlike some other recent nights, propagation from FL very good this time with
WYFR inbooming on its four 31m channels.
